RowEditEnded Event
See Also  Send Feedback
Intersoft.Client.UI.Data Namespace > UXGridView Class : RowEditEnded Event






Occurs when a row edit has been committed or canceled.

Syntax

Visual Basic (Declaration) 
Public Event RowEditEnded As UXGridViewRowEditEndedEventHandler
Visual Basic (Usage)Copy Code
Dim instance As UXGridView
Dim handler As UXGridViewRowEditEndedEventHandler
 
AddHandler instance.RowEditEnded, handler
C# 
public event UXGridViewRowEditEndedEventHandler RowEditEnded
Delphi 
public event RowEditEnded: UXGridViewRowEditEndedEventHandler; 
JScript 
In JScript, you can handle the events defined by another class, but you cannot define your own.
Managed Extensions for C++ 
public: __event UXGridViewRowEditEndedEventHandler* RowEditEnded
C++/CLI 
public:
event UXGridViewRowEditEndedEventHandler^ RowEditEnded

Event Data

The event handler receives an argument of type UXGridViewRowEditEndedEventArgs containing data related to this event. The following UXGridViewRowEditEndedEventArgs properties provide information specific to this event.

PropertyDescription
EditAction Gets the EditAction that indicates whether the edit was committed or canceled.
Handled (Inherited from Intersoft.Client.Framework.ISRoutedEventArgs) 
HandledBy (Inherited from Intersoft.Client.Framework.ISRoutedEventArgs) 
IsHandledByPrimitive (Inherited from Intersoft.Client.Framework.ISRoutedEventArgs) 
OriginalSource (Inherited from Intersoft.Client.Framework.ISRoutedEventArgs) 
RoutedEvent (Inherited from Intersoft.Client.Framework.ISRoutedEventArgs) 
Row Gets the row that has just exited edit mode.
Source (Inherited from Intersoft.Client.Framework.ISRoutedEventArgs)
